Sisters to sue church over sex abuse claims

THREE sisters now in their 30s and 40s are suing the Roman Catholic Archdiocese of Los Angeles, a parish and a priest who they said sexually abused them as children in the 1970s.

Sisters to sue church over sex abuse claims

Jackie Dennis, Riva Kennedy and Wendy Kennedy said they took the case to civil court because of a US Supreme Court ruling that overturned a state law that lifted the statute of limitations in criminal prosecution of old molestation cases.

The sisters claim parish priest George Neville Rucker molested all of them at different times, sometimes in their own home while their mother was cooking dinner for the priest. Only recently, they said, did they discover they were all victims.

ā€œOver a year ago, when I first discovered Rucker’s face in the newspaper, I was totally unaware these abuses had happened to my sisters,ā€ said Ms Dennis, 42.

ā€œI kept my secret. I lived with my secret totally unaware of the abuses on my sisters.ā€

Rucker, 83, was arrested on a cruise ship off Alaska last year and was charged with molesting 12 girls over a 30-year period.

But in July, after the Supreme Court ruling, the charges against Rucker were dismissed and he returned to his home in a facility for retired priests.
